qt平台 (qt平台插件怎么安装)
Qt 是一个跨平台的应用程序框架,用于开发图形用户界面(GUI)应用程序。它提供了丰富的功能集,包括:
- 一个强大的图形系统,支持各种图形引擎
- 一套完整的窗口小部件,用于创建自定义用户界面
- 网络、数据库和线程支持
- 一个用于翻译应用程序的国际化框架
Qt 是用 C++ 编写的,并且可以在各种平台上运行,包括:
- Windows
- macOS
- Linux
- 嵌入式系统
Qt 平台插件
Qt 平台插件是一组库,用于将 Qt 应用程序集成到特定平台。例如,Qt Windows 插件允许 Qt 应用程序与 Windows 操作系统和 API 进行交互。同样地,Qt macOS 插件允许 Qt 应用程序与 macOS 操作系统和 API 进行交互。
Qt 平台插件可以在 Qt 安装程序中找到,也可以从 Qt 网站下载。安装插件后,需要在应用程序中注册插件,以便应用程序能够使用它。这可以通过以下方式完成:
QGuiApplication::setPlatformPlugin(new QWindowsIntegrationPlugin);
安装 Qt 平台插件后,应用程序将能够访问特定平台提供的功能。例如,在 Windows 上,应用程序将能够访问 Windows 注册表、文件系统和图形设备。同样地,在 macOS 上,应用程序将能够访问 macOS 菜单栏、Dock 和沙箱环境。
以下是一些最常见的 Qt 平台插件:
- Qt Windows 插件
- Qt macOS 插件
- Qt Linux 插件
- Qt 嵌入式 Linux 插件
安装 Qt 平台插件
Qt 平台插件可以从 Qt 安装程序或 Qt 网站下载。安装步骤如下:
- 下载 Qt 安装程序或 Qt 平台插件软件包。
- 运行安装程序或解压缩软件包。
- 按照安装向导中的说明进行操作。
- 完成安装后,在应用程序中注册插件。
安装 Qt 平台插件后,应用程序将能够访问特定平台提供的功能。例如,在 Windows 上,应用程序将能够访问 Windows 注册表、文件系统和图形设备。同样地,在 macOS 上,应用程序将能够访问 macOS 菜单栏、Dock 和沙箱环境。
结论
Qt 平台插件是将 Qt 应用程序集成到特定平台的必要组件。它们允许应用程序访问特定平台提供的功能,从而创建原生且集成的用户体验。安装 Qt 平台插件的过程相对简单,并大大提高了应用程序的功能和跨平台兼容性。
版权声明
本文仅代表作者观点,不代表武汉桑拿立场。
本文系作者授权发表,未经许可,不得转载。